    DESCRIPTION OF DUTIES/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

    Supervise and direct technical personnel to develop and negotiate construction and design management and supplemental engineering service contracts as it relates to the Signal Maintenance Section with the Traffic Operations branch in Transportation & Drainage Operations.

    Interface with departments and outside agencies or firms to discuss programs and projects. Administer and negotiate claim change orders. Perform personnel functions, such as evaluating subordinate performance, interviewing prospective personnel, training subordinates and recommending disciplinary action. Plan, organize, direct, and review major design and construction contracts. Supervise preparation of design and construction contracts for special projects and construction administration contracts; plans personnel allotments; maintains budget control over personnel and contracts. Maintain construction records and reports to management on construction contracts; provide input for departmental decision-making and planning. Respond to complaints or inquiries from citizens, City officials or outside agencies; represents the department at conferences and meetings. Provide management of multiple contracts of various sizes. Review, approve, and track consultant or testing laboratory estimates. May develop standard protocol for environmental and geo-technical investigations.

    MINIMUM REQUIREMENTS

    EDUCATIONAL REQUIREMENTS
    Requires a Bachelor's degree in Architecture, Civil Engineering, Construction Management, Landscape Architecture, Project Management or a closely related field based on the responsibilities of the position. Considerable knowledge of design or construction is required.

    EXPERIENCE REQUIREMENTS
    Six (6) years of experience in construction, construction inspection, design, landscape design, geo-technical, environmental or a closely related field are required.

    Substitutions: A Master's degree in Architecture, Civil Engineering, Construction Management, Landscape Architecture, Project Management or a closely related field may be substituted for two (2) years of the above experience requirement.

    Directly related professional architectural, construction or landscape design experience may be substituted for the education requirement on a year-for-year basis.

    OUR HISTORY  

    In 1937, as Houston began its ascent to become the energy capital of the world, the city acquired the site of its first major commercial airport, William P. Hobby Airport.

    As the City of Houston continued to grow so did the Houston Airport System, adding George Bush Intercontinental Airport in 1969 and Ellington Airport in 1984.  Today, George Bush Intercontinental Airport serves as the premier long-haul international airport facility, while Ellington Airport supports both general aviation flights as well as a host of government/military operations. Hobby Airport opened an international concourse and welcomed back international service in October 2015, serving destinations in Latin American and the Caribbean.
